Ketogenic Diet is an established treatment for epilepsy with 13 RCTs and over a century of clinical use.
Anticonvulsant medications are used in the treatment of Bipolar Disorder and a large patient group is calling for more research on ketogenic diet for bipolar.
Learn about our pilot study of a ketogenic diet for Bipolar Disorder and newly founded UKRI MRC Metabolic Psychiatry Hub.
